CARPARK SCI-FI announces new EP The Hundred Halves
Listen to his single 'Wake Me Up' below.
CARPARK SCI-FI has announced a new EP The Hundred Halves. It's set to drop Wednesday, April 1, via Blue Arrow Records.
CARPARK SCI-FI (real name Gav Cowley) is an audio and visual artist prominent in the underground Dublin music scene. He joined the Cleveland-based Blue Arrow Records in 2023 with his debut EP This Is.
Lead single 'Wake Me Up' is out now. The music video features Cowley's own illustrations.
"On a micro level, this song 'Wake Me Up' is me trying to work some personal things out," Cowley says of the track. "I kinda free-styled a lot of these lyrics in order to not over think. It’s also maybe a call to... start creating again, start moving again, start noticing again, start being hopeful again. To wake up to love."
"On a macro level, with all the bad stuff going on in the world, it’s easy to lose hope. But we all grew up imagining a world where everybody would be looked after. There are heaps of sound people out there. Kindness, sharing, looking out for each other, believing everyone has worth and the right to be here."
The Hundred Halves will be available on a limited edition 10" vinyl. Pre-order the EP here.
CARPARK SCI-FI will be launching The Hundred Halves at Dublin's Curveball on Saturday, April 4. Tickets are available now.
He'll play Bennigan's in Derry on Saturday, April 11, and John Lee's Bar and Venue in Tullamore on Saturday, April 25.
